Добавить в корзинуПозвонить
Найти в Дзене

CI/CD: робот, который работает вместо тебя (и не ноет в чате)

CI/CD звучит как название новой поп-группы из Кореи. Но на деле это твой лучший друг в разработке, который экономит время и нервы. 1️⃣ Ты пишешь новый код. Думаешь: «Всё идеально, я гений».
2️⃣ Заливаешь в репозиторий. Тут же включается «робот-надзиратель», который гоняет твой код по тестам.
3️⃣ Если всё зелёное → проект сам выкатывается на сервер.
Если красное → держи успокоительное и готовься к правкам. Даже если ты работаешь один, CI/CD — это как ассистент, который всегда рядом:
— «Брат, тут ошибка. Я тебя не пущу в прод, пока не исправишь». Начни с простого: пусть pipeline хотя бы запускает тесты. Потом уже добавишь деплой, уведомления и прочие «ништяки». 🔥 Итог: CI/CD — это не мода. Это как посудомойка. Один раз попробуешь — и уже никогда не вернёшься к «мытью вручную».
Оглавление

CI/CD звучит как название новой поп-группы из Кореи. Но на деле это твой лучший друг в разработке, который экономит время и нервы.

🔄 Как это выглядит в жизни

1️⃣ Ты пишешь новый код. Думаешь: «Всё идеально, я гений».

2️⃣ Заливаешь в репозиторий. Тут же включается «робот-надзиратель», который гоняет твой код по тестам.

3️⃣ Если всё зелёное → проект сам выкатывается на сервер.

Если красное → держи успокоительное и готовься к правкам.

🎯 Чем это круто

  • Больше никаких «ночных деплоев через FTP», когда ты в 2 ночи загружаешь файлы и молишься богам DevOps.
  • Новые фичи попадают к пользователям быстрее, чем ты успеваешь допить кофе.
  • Ошибки ловятся ещё ДО того, как код доехал до продакшена и развалил жизнь всем пользователям.

🧰 Топ-3 инструмента для CI/CD

  • GitHub Actions — идеально для пет-проектов и экспериментов.
  • GitLab CI — когда у тебя команда и все любят порядок (ну, хотя бы делают вид).
  • Jenkins — дед, который видел все войны, но всё ещё тащит.

💡 Лайфхак Neo Journal

Даже если ты работаешь один, CI/CD — это как ассистент, который всегда рядом:

— «Брат, тут ошибка. Я тебя не пущу в прод, пока не исправишь».

Начни с простого: пусть pipeline хотя бы запускает тесты. Потом уже добавишь деплой, уведомления и прочие «ништяки».

🔥 Итог: CI/CD — это не мода. Это как посудомойка. Один раз попробуешь — и уже никогда не вернёшься к «мытью вручную».